Newly found fossils of lizard-like animal are the oldest ever discovered

The oldest known relative of lizards has been uncovered in the UK.

A new species of ancient reptile, known as Agriodontosaurus helsbypetrae, reveals that the evolution of these animals was quite different than scientists had imagined.

An extinct species has revealed new twists in the tale of lizards and their relatives.

Discovered near the town of Sidmouth in Devon, Agriodontosaurus helsbypetrae was an insect-eating reptile that lived more than 241 million years ago during the Middle Triassic. It’s part of a reptile group known as the lepidosaurs, which contains snakes, lizards and an animal known as the tuatara.
